My power steering feels like its slowly dying and has been getting slightly worse. It is tighter in the cold morning and loosens up a bit after driving 20mins or so but is still feeling tight. It varies also sometimes its looser feeling then others and steering return/feel improves. Now I flushed it about 6mnths ago and it didn't help. It does groan when turning slightly left still but I'm guessing that is just air trapped maybe or a blockage? It's weird because the fluid looks brand new still (see-through) so I don't think any contamination has got to it but it seems like the fluid is barely circulating in the resovoir. My rack and pinion has a tiny seepage from the driver side; seal on that large nut and gasket but I haven't had to add any fluid since I flushed it so the leak must be very small. Do you think I should try to re-bleed the air out or does it sound like it is too far gone?

The rack has morning sickness and will need to be replaced. You can limp it along but it is on its way out. FWIW, don't waste money on the ones from AZ or advance. Do yourself a favor and get a ford unit.

Update... I decided to try and re-flush the ps fluid. This time I flushed about 3 quarts mercon 3 through it instead of power steering fluid like was in there until color changed from clear to red. I then pulled the computer fuse and cranked the car while turning the wheel left and right. After I could see some bubbles in the fluid so I guess it worked and it seems to steer better than before. Does this bleeding method hurt the battery alot it felt pretty hot when done?
